Find the best attractions near Waikawa

Waikawa is an idyllic destination for outdoor enthusiasts and beach lovers, offering stunning scenery and various attractions such as waterfalls and beautiful bays. Ideal for adventure seekers and those seeking a romantic getaway, visitors can explore the Waikawa Marina and nearby tourist spots. Don't miss the picturesque Waikawa Bay, perfect for a relaxing day by the water. With so much to see and do, Waikawa promises an unforgettable experience for every traveller.

  • Porpoise Bay Beach: Experience the laid-back beach vibes at Porpoise Bay Beach, located just 1.6km from Waikawa. Relax on the soft sands, swim in the clear waters, or enjoy a leisurely stroll along the shoreline, all while soaking in the stunning coastal scenery.
  • Curio Bay Petrified Forest: A 4.8km journey from Waikawa leads you to the Curio Bay Petrified Forest, where you can explore fascinating outdoor landscapes. Marvel at the ancient fossilised trees and enjoy breathtaking views of the bay, making it a perfect spot for nature lovers and photographers.
  • McLean Falls: Venture 11.6kms from Waikawa to McLean Falls, where romance meets adventure. Hike through lush greenery to witness the dramatic waterfall cascading into a tranquil pool, providing an ideal backdrop for a memorable day amidst nature.

Best time to go to Waikawa

The best time to visit Waikawa is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the weather like in Waikawa?

The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 56°F, while the coldest months are July and August with an average of 45°F. Average annual precipitation for Waikawa is 44 inches.
